haskell/aeson

Document `Key` and mention it in the tutorial

Open

#985 opened on Jan 7, 2023

View on GitHub
 (2 comments) (1 reaction) (0 assignees)Haskell (1,298 stars) (334 forks)batch import
help wanted

Description

In https://hackage.haskell.org/package/aeson-2.1.1.0/docs/Data-Aeson-Key.html#t:Key there are no haddocks, and the "How to use this library" section has not a single example that shows non-literal keys being used (coming e.g. from Text).

It would be great if:

  • Haddocks were added to Key that motivate its existence, so that e.g. hovering it from an IDE gives tips on how to obtain that type
  • an example of keys being converted from Text, so that beginners or upgraders from pre-2.0 have an esier time

Contributor guide

Document `Key` and mention it in the tutorial · haskell/aeson#985 | Good First Issue